PA3-17 is an autologous chimeric antigen receptor (CAR) T-cell therapy specifically engineered to target CD7, a cell surface glycoprotein highly expressed on malignant T cells in diseases such as relapsed/refractory T-lymphoblastic leukemia/lymphoma (r/r T-ALL/LBL) and other CD7-positive hematologic malignancies. Developed by PersonGen BioTherapeutics, PA3-17 uses a novel approach to prevent fratricide among CAR-T cells by blocking the expression of CD7 on the surface of the therapeutic T cells through an anti-CD7 protein expression blocker (PEBL). This allows for effective expansion and persistence of CAR-T cells targeting malignant CD7-expressing lymphocytes. Clinical studies have demonstrated encouraging safety and efficacy profiles in patients with r/r T-ALL/LBL, with high overall response rates and manageable toxicity[1][2][5][6].
